Sims Appoints New Safety Director

Bob Berry has joined the team at Sims Crane and Equipment Co., Tampa, Fla. as safety director. Dean Sims, vice president of marketing, said that as crane and rigging standards become more focused on rigging and signalman certification, the Sims Crane team aims to set a standard in providing basic rigging and signalman courses throughout the organization, and as a resource for construction industry partners.

Berry has been in the crane and rigging industry for 35 years, most recently as a practical examiner and a crane safety specialist. Berry began his IUOE apprenticeship with local 925 in Tampa, Fla. in 1972, graduating at the top of his class.  He was an operator and foreman before becoming a crane safety specialist.  After pursuing involvement in the NCCCO operator certification program, he became the first practical examiner in the U.S. for NCCCO.

Berry has also had a 10-year side career as Bobo the Clown, making regular trips to local hospitals to perform for children, and organizing events for the Special Olympics.
